Was looking for a good portable set myself for unamped, ipod/iphone use only and decided on the Phiaton MS 400. They have better bass and are more portable, i.e. smaller than the PS 500; they're great headphones to just pick up and start enjoying music with right off the bat. Based on the song you posted, I think the MS 400 would be a great choice particularly if like me you want something really portable that blocks out a lot of sound and preserves some bass while you're commuting.
 
They're available at Amazon for $170-183 depending on color: both are far below your stated budget. If you want to spend $400 on the best possible set, you can do better than the Phiatons. But if you'd like to save as much as possible, the MS 400 offer great value.
